Just got my Bombshell in the mail today. Placed my order over the phone and five days later it's in my hand, considering the two days we didnt have mail that to me is great!!! I won't revisit my customer service experience with these guys but it is def a A+.

Initial thoughts: Came packaged with care wrapped and taped with foam type packaging material for safe transport. Time also must have remembered me telling him about me not every trying fruit flavored juices yet so he threw in a couple samples as well which I always think is very cool. Picking it up it's got a little weight to it. I bought the motobyke silver color and it's been polished very well. I can see a few machine marks on the top of it where it unscrews to place the battery in but upon feeling it there is not a single flaw or blemish in it's finish. When screwing and unscrewing the top it is very smooth, no catching on the threads and locks up tightly with ease. There is a small hole drilled in the bottom which assume is a vent for the battery. It also looks like the 510 battery connector has a hole in it but am not 100% sure if it might be soldered closed. The fact that it is silver with the brass connector and brass recessed button gives it a sharp contrast and sexy look. It stands alone by itself. On its side if you roll it it won't hit the button making me believe that I wont have to worry about accidental ignition of the switch.

I usually vape with 902's so I had to place an order for a 510 atty. Unfortunately for me I dont have a cart that fits it. But Wait... my 902 atty's work on 510 battery connectors Jackpot!!!!!!

So I threw in a freshly charged Trustfire 18650 2400mAh protected Li Ion Battery, a clean 902 on with a freshly lipton pyramid mod cartridge and pulled out the 24mg 555 Lite I bought with my order. Primed my Atty and.....

Let me tell you something, this is my first Big Battery Mod, I expected it to have some power but never expected this..This sucker Vapes. I dripped a couple drops into my atty threw on a full clean fresh 510 cart and ripped it.

i wont go into flavor because this is an equipment review (it was what I expected out of 555) so I'll just talk about vapor production and Throat Hit.

Vapor Production: Holy Vapor!!!! This thing really puts it out there. It was definitely warmer than what Im used to but also something I expected and was looking for when I purchased this. I am taking rips while typing this and its a good thing I can type because for a couple seconds after I exhale I can't see my laptop screen.

Throat Hit: Again, incredible, I actually have to be careful or it makes me cough. I have adopted a deep lung inhale when vaping some of my other PV's when I'm looking for that throat hit. not with this though. I am guaranteed a coughing fit if I do this. I just pull the Vapor into my mouth and then inhale and the Throat Hit is phenomenal!!!

Concluding Thoughts: I am very happy with this purchase. For affordability, style, design, size and performance it's a homerun. I don't have the knowledge to compare this Mod to any other one as it's my first Big Battery, however, it exceeded all of my expectations and would recommend it to anyone looking to purchase their first BB Mod. It's a great mod, actually I bring it everywhere with me, I use trustfire 18650's with a rating of 2400mAh and it last all day.
I've being using clouds of Vapor 2.8ohm clearomizers on it and it's a great set-up.

The Bombshell was my first Big Battery Mod and still love it. I got it in the silver. Tim at HotVapes is a great guy and he told me he's gonna have some different atty's available soon.

I did a lot of research on BB mods before I purchased one and the Bombshell was for me the best. Affordability, Durability and ability to vape at 3.7 or 6V is great. I guess you could even Vape at 7.4 if you wanted to however it's not for me. Way too hot!!

you can't beat it for the price, the only weak link is the flimsy button, but it's my everyday vaper at Castle Vapenstein and I am very happy with mine

I do have concerns with the brass atty connector. If you wore it out it would mean a new unit, as there is no easy or cheap way to replace what I'm guessing is a press-fit connector. Certainly there is a harder metal than brass that mod makers can use for atty connections?

These are petty gripes on what is a fantastic $60 mod.
